Subject: Re: [PATCH] sane-toolchain-*: add -g to FULL_OPTIMIZATION to make -dbg packages more usefull

On 03/01/2011 10:50 AM, Otavio Salvador wrote:
> On Tue, Mar 1, 2011 at 17:39, Tom Rini<tom_rini@mentor.com>  wrote:
>> On 03/01/2011 10:03 AM, Otavio Salvador wrote:
>>> Having -g shouldn't hurt since the debugging symbols end up on the
>>> -dbg packages. Why having it "disabled" by default?
>>
>> In the case of host packages, I disable debug symbols (don't want, takes up
>> space when shipping).  In the case of target stuff, we may want more debug
>> info to be available.  Or one may want to have less because again, it takes
>> up space when shipping.
>
> I see but this could be overriden by distro, couldn't it?

That's why I'm asking for the -g part to be put into a variable so that 
it can be overriden easily, in all cases, without needing to know the 
special cases (ie glibc).
